Felicis Ventures has successfully raised its largest fund to date, a significant development indicating sustained investor confidence in the venture capital asset class, particularly amidst prevailing broader market uncertainties. While the specific size of this record fund remains undisclosed, its scale suggests a strong conviction by Felicis in identifying and capitalizing on opportunities within early-stage companies. This influx of capital into the venture ecosystem could lead to increased competition for deals, potentially influencing valuations for startups and shaping the deal flow landscape.
